Overview Join Takeda as a Vice President, Global Program Leader (GPL) in our Cambridge office.

The GPL is responsible for the strategy, planning, and execution of global oncology programs from discovery through commercialization and lifecycle management, ensuring regulatory approval, product launch, and equitable patient access worldwide.

Key Responsibilities

Define the asset strategy and lead all development and lifecycle projects throughout the product lifecycle.

Drive regulatory approval, launch, and global patient access, collaborating with cross‑functional teams.

Communicate and partner with leadership across functions, ensuring alignment with Takeda values of Patient‑Trust‑Reputation‑Business.

Manage budgets, monitor variances, and report program progress, risks, and issues to executive management.

Lead and support the Global Program Team (GPT), providing strategic and tactical leadership and facilitating effective matrix management.

Develop and maintain systems for tracking KPIs, trending, learning, and program performance.

Identify and mitigate project risks, proactively managing issues to resolution.

Contribute to new opportunity assessments and feasibility studies for potential global programs.

Promote organizational reputation through stakeholder engagement and active participation in the GPL community.

Required Experience, Education, Knowledge and Skills

Advanced scientific degree (MD, PhD, or PharmD) or MBA.

Minimum 15 years of experience in the pharmaceutical industry, including research & development and commercial operations.

Minimum 10 years of interdisciplinary global experience with complex projects, strategy and execution, and matrix team management.

Preferred Qualifications

Advanced degree in science or business.

Broad business/enterprise orientation.

Experience managing multiple NME global approvals.

Passion for developing others into future leaders.

Travel Requirements

Willingness to travel for meetings and client sites, including overnight trips; approximately 20‑25 % travel.
